【启动-嵌入式开发】【第一步】虚拟机安装Ubuntu+VMtools+换源+ssh

如何搭建开发环境

一、虚拟机安装Ubuntu

  首先,我们需要在本机安装虚拟机,过程非常简单,网上破解教程也很多,在此不做过多赘述,只是最后要注意本机是否开启了虚拟化。
  接下来就是安装Ubuntu,去官网下载镜像,目前最新的是18.04,我这里为了方便,所以采用的是16.04

过程截图
1、在这里插入图片描述
2、在这里插入图片描述
3、在这里插入图片描述
4、在这里插入图片描述
5、在这里插入图片描述
6、在这里插入图片描述
7、在这里插入图片描述
8、在这里插入图片描述
9、在这里插入图片描述
10、在这里插入图片描述
11、在这里插入图片描述
12、在这里插入图片描述
13、在这里插入图片描述
14、在这里插入图片描述
15、在这里插入图片描述

到此,也就完成了虚拟机的配置工作。
  安装过程也是非常之简单,就是下一步下一步

过程截图
1、在这里插入图片描述
2、在这里插入图片描述
3、在这里插入图片描述
4、在这里插入图片描述
5、在这里插入图片描述
6、在这里插入图片描述
7、在这里插入图片描述
8、在这里插入图片描述

到此就结束了,最后要注意,安装完以后重启要移去安装盘。否则会报错!

过程截图
1、在这里插入图片描述
2、在这里插入图片描述
3、在这里插入图片描述
4、在这里插入图片描述
6、在这里插入图片描述

到此,我们安装Ubuntu的过程就结束了!

二、安装vmtools

  接下来就是安装vmtools,这样我们就可以进行复制和文件拷贝操作了。

过程截图
1、在这里插入图片描述
2、在这里插入图片描述
3、在这里插入图片描述
4、在这里插入图片描述
5、除了第一个按y,接下来一路enter就好
6、在这里插入图片描述
7、在这里插入图片描述

最后,reboot重启就好了。

三、换源

  在这里,为了不给不懂vi的读者造成障碍,所以使用gedit进行编辑操作

过程截图
1、首先就是打开控制台
2、在这里插入图片描述
3、备份
4、在这里插入图片描述
5、开始修改
6、在这里插入图片描述
7、全部删除,然后填入阿里的镜像,在下面有
8、更新源 sudo apt update
9、更新 软件 sudo apt upgrade 这里切记不要更新 不要更新 不要更新,一更新,依赖就会出问题,有些东西就装不上了,最起码,我现在是这样感觉的,可能重启会好点吧,反正我当初崩在了这,就重新玩了
deb http://mirrors.ustc.edu.cn/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 trusty-backports main restricted universe multiverse

deb http://mirrors.aliyun.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 trusty-backports main restricted universe multiverse

deb http://mirrors.sohu.com/ubuntu/ trusty main restricted universe multiverse
deb http://mirrors.sohu.com/ubuntu/ trusty-security main restricted universe multiverse
deb http://mirrors.sohu.com/ubuntu/ trusty-updates main restricted universe multiverse
deb http://mirrors.sohu.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b http://mirrors.sohu.com/ubuntu/ trusty-backports main restricted universe multiverse
deb-src http://mirrors.sohu.com/ubuntu/ trusty main restricted universe multiverse
deb-src http://mirrors.sohu.com/ubuntu/ trusty-security main restricted universe multiverse
deb-src http://mirrors.sohu.com/ubuntu/ trusty-updates main restricted universe multiverse
deb-src http://mirrors.sohu.com/ubuntu/ trusty-proposed main restricted universe multiverse
deb-src http://mirrors.sohu.com/ubuntu/ trusty-backports main restricted universe multiverse

四、安装ssh

  接下来就是ssh的配置,我们输入 sshd会出现提示

在这里插入图片描述
1、输入 sudo apt install openssh-server

2、安装完成后,使用root登录系统

3、编辑 SSH 的文件,将PermitRootLogin 的值改为yes

$ vim /etc/ssh/sshd_config
4、因为为root账户设置了密码,所以还要更改PermitEmptyPasswords为 no。然后:wq保存文件

5、然后重启ssh服务

$ services ssh restart
6、然后打开xshell点击文件——新建会话,输入相应的IP地址和用户名密码进行登录就可以了。

好了,就是这样!

参考:
Ubuntu 18.04修改默认源为国内源
VMware安装Ubuntu及VMware Tools实用总结
CentOS 和 Ubuntu 更新源
Ubuntu 16.04 几个国内更新源
ubuntu 无法使用 SSH root 账户远程访问

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值